Why does splunkweb hang when I try to access it with Internet Explorer 8 over SSL?

yodaut
Explorer

I can access my Splunk web and login, run searches, etc. with Chrome, Firefox, Safari... pretty much any browser that isn't IE8.

When I try to access the Splunk login URL with IE8 loads about half the page content, then hangs.

Subsequent access to Splunk web login URL with other non-IE browsers fail as well.

If I restart splunk web, other non-IE browsers work again. If I then try to access splunkweb with IE8 again, it hangs again and I'm back to where I started.

Has anyone seen this? Any suggestions (other than "don't use IE") ?

Splunk 4.1.1 build 78281 on server running Splunk Web interface (and primary indexer).

Internet Explorer 8 + Windows 7 64-bit.

Confirmed from multiple machines.

I have experienced the same problem and I am required to leave sslv2 off.. so supportSSLV3Only = True must stay on.. For FF, IE6/7/8, Chrome they all experienced problems. Opera did not because it does not support sslv2 anymore.. If you turn off sslv2 support in ie6/7/8 this problem goes away. In doing that Chrome will start working because it uses IE's settings. Firefox about:config and turn off sslv2.. All my browsers I didn't have to turn it off it was already off.. but I had cohorts that I had to have turn it off in order to access splunkweb. you can duplicate the problem with openssl

[root@csc06splunkdev01 default]# openssl s_client -ssl3 -connect servername:8000 * works just fine, but have to specify to use ssl3 *

[root@csc06splunkdev01 default]# openssl s_client -connect servername:8000 CONNECTED(00000003) write:errno=104 ** fails cuz it defaults to sslv2 **

splunk-4.1.4-82143

Yodaut says:

i may have solved my own problem... i had:

# Allow only SSLv3 connections if true 
# NOTE: Enabling this may cause some browsers problems
#supportSSLV3Only = True 

set to true my web.conf... maybe IE8 and splunkweb really really don't like that. i've commented out the line and restarted services. things appear to be a bit happier now.

Note some ssl problems have been solved between 4.1.2. and 4.1.4, so it's possible the workaround may no longer be necessary to avoid wedging splunkweb, but probably is still recommended for compatibility with that combination of software.
